longrideshields-1 05-12-2011 05:14 PM


Originally Posted by pauletich (Post 8310726)
SO LRS what would you recommandation be for a good recurved windshield that blocks the wind and allows you to enjoy your stereo?

I hope Im not comming off too arogant but it depends on the height of the rider.

In most cases a rider under 5 foot 9 inches can get away with a 6 inch ultra or flat top ultra.

A rider between 5'10" and 6 foot can do an 7 - 9 inch windshield comfortably.

That would be getting the wind completely off the rider.

There are other factors to take into account as well such as seat height, average torso height.

Essentially you want a flip up shield to line up with the top lip or tip or tip of your nose. That will allow the rider to see over the windshield even after he is settled in and slouching after the first 20 minutes of riding.

longrideshields-1 05-12-2011 05:15 PM

obviously the measurement for a street glide is different than the measurement for a Ultra classic and even different on a trike.

SDVmnt 05-12-2011 06:22 PM

It all depends on your seat, your height and your distance from the fairing. I have the HD windsplitter and it fits perfectly. Get a little sunglass chatter if I get a strange cross wind but I attribute most of that to the air coming from below.

I tried the KW 6.5 but found with my position to that shield, it shot all the wind right into my ears.
6'1, Brawler seat which is back ~2-3" and down a couple inches from stock.

The windsplitter seems to kick the wind out further around my head.
